The Mayville Cardinals will venture away from home to face off against the Winnebago Lutheran Academy Vikings at 5:00 p.m. on Monday. Mayville's pitching crew has only allowed 2.9 runs per game this season, so Winnebago Lutheran Academy's hitters will have their work cut out for them.
Mayville came out on top against Horicon on Friday thanks in part to the team's impressive five-run second inning. The Cardinals never let the Marshmen get on the board and left with a 10-0 victory. The Cardinals haven't had any issues with the Marshmen recently, as the game was their fourth consecutive win against them.
Allie Schwirtz made a big impact while hitting and pitching. She looked comfortable on the mound, not allowing a single earned run and allowing only one hit while striking out seven over four innings pitched. She has been nothing but reliable: she hasn't given up more than two walks any time she's pitched this season. She was also big at the plate, going a perfect 3-for-3 with two doubles, two RBI, and one run. That's the most doubles she has posted since back in April.

In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Addie Anderson, who went 3-for-4 with three RBI and one run. Those three RBI gave her a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Izzy McFadden, who went 2-for-4 with two runs.
Meanwhile, after a string of three wins, Winnebago Lutheran Academy's good fortune finally ran out on Friday. They fell just short of Princeton/Green Lake by a score of 4-2.
Mayville's victory bumped their record up to 11-3. As for Winnebago Lutheran Academy, their defeat dropped their record down to 4-8.
Mayville came out on top in a nail-biter against Winnebago Lutheran Academy in their previous meeting back in April, sneaking past 3-1.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Cardinals since the squad won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
